DESCRIPTION:

This lovely two double bedroom end of terrace house is situated on the western side of Bridgwater and served by gas fired central heating, benefitting from a garage to the rear and off-road parking for a small vehicle.

The accommodation comprises of door to entrance hall, with stairs to first floor landing. On the ground floor there is a living room with useful storage cupboard and front aspect window. The property has a kitchen/dining room with a range of high- and low-level units and recesses for domestic appliances. The kitchen opens to a lobby area where there is another useful storage cupboard and a convenient cloak room with WC and well-lit by a window. Also to the ground floor is a side covered area which extends to a lean-to / sunroom with door opening to the garden.

To the first floor of the property are two good sized bedrooms with a cupboard to the master bedroom housing the gas boiler powering domestic hot water and central heating system. Also to the first floor is a bathroom suite with bath, WC, wash hand basin, double glazed window with shower over and a heated towel rail.

Outside to the rear of the property the garden is predominantly laid to lawn and enclosed by fencing leading to the garage which has a metal up and over door and parking area to the rear for a small vehicle.

LOCATION:

Situated on the popular and favoured west side of Bridgwater with local junior and senior schools of high repute close to hand. The town centre is a level walk away with all the shops and facilities that Bridgwater has to offer. Bridgwater offers a full range of amenities including retail, educational and leisure facilities. There are regular bus services to Taunton, Weston-super-Mare and Burnham-on-Sea plus a daily coach service to London Hammersmith. Main line links are available via Bridgwater Railway Station.
